Learning and Living the Twelve Steps

The 12 steps of AA provide essential principles that help members overcome addiction while building spiritual and emotional resilience. In AA Meetings Burlingham, participants move through these steps with the guidance of sponsors and encouragement from peers. These teachings promote honesty, forgiveness, and service, empowering individuals to create a healthier and more balanced life.

The Role of Therapy and Mental Health in Recovery

Addressing mental health is an important step in long-term sobriety. Many who attend AA Meetings Burlingham choose to complement their recovery with professional counseling. Licensed experts, available through therapists near me, can help individuals process trauma, anxiety, or depression. This balanced approach supports both emotional healing and physical sobriety.


Finding the Right Meeting for You

Everyone’s path in recovery looks different. The AA meetings directory allows people to explore open, closed, or specialized meetings in Burlingham. Some groups focus on beginners, while others support long-term sobriety. By trying different types, each individual can find the environment that best supports their unique journey.
